Hey Jon! This broom is amazing but is there and easier way to make the kickstand because I don’t know how to work with metal and I really want to make it
Minz, I actually considered buying moldable plastic and making the kick stand. It is really easy to shape and paint. But with the weight of this broom I was unsure if it could hold the weight when dry. But there is also 2 gauge wire that you can bend by hand. That would probably do the trick as well.
